what are dental implants

Understanding dental implants

Dental implants are artificial roots surgically inserted in the jaw to replace missing teeth, allowing for a secure fit of prosthetic replacement teeth. A titanium alloy post is positioned beneath the gum-line by an experienced dental professional and fused with surroundingbone through a process called osseointegration.

Are dental implants right for you?

A good candidate for dental implants is someone with healthy gums and enough bone in the jaw to hold a titanium implant, as well as individuals committed to daily oral hygiene. Those suffering from gum disease, heavy smokers or those on certain medications may not be eligible.

Dental implant maintenance

Brush and floss your dental implants routinely to keep them in good condition. Use an interdental brush for tougher-to-reach areas and consider using a mild, alcohol-free mouthwash for an extra clean feeling. Visit your implant dentist regularly to ensure the best longterm success of your implants.

What are the different types of dental implants?

Dental implant restorations include single, multiple, and full mouth options. Single implants are used to replace a single missing tooth while multiple implants can be used to secure dentures or fixed bridges that restore several teeth at once. A full-mouth restoration uses both types of dental implants in combination to securely supplant a whole arc of teeth.

Why is a dental implant procedure costly?

Dental implants are costly due to several factors including the high-quality materials used, the complexity of the procedure, and the expertise of dental professionals. Implants require titanium posts, which are expensive, as well as custom prosthetic teeth. The process involves precise surgical placement and a lengthy healing period. Furthermore, dental professionals need extensive training and experience to perform implant procedures, which adds to the overall expense of this advanced dental treatment.

Are dental implants painful?

Dental implants may cause some discomfort during the procedure, but this often subsides soon after. Afterwards patients are able to resume their usual activities and may experience mild soreness or swelling, which can be effectively managed with over-the-counter pain killers or a cold compress. Overall, most people don’t find the process painful at all and have little more than minor post procedure discomfort that dissipates fairly quickly.

Options beyond dental implants

Alternatives to dental implants are bridges, dentures, and partial dentures. Bridges replace a missing tooth with one or more artificial teeth by joining the replacement to the adjacent natural teeth; dentures replace many missing teeth; and partial dentures fill in spaces left by one or multiple missing teeth without involving other anchors.
